Elevate nursing practices as a Cardiology Nurse Educator at Southlake Health in Newmarket, ON. Guide staff through education while implementing evidence-based protocols in this full-time role.
This permanent position calls for an experienced Nurse Educator to collaborate with interdisciplinary teams. The role focuses on clinical leadership, educational program development, and patient care strategies. With 3-5 years in critical care nursing, you will impact nursing excellence at Southlake Health.
Key Responsibilities:
• Plan and evaluate clinical education programs for staff
• Coordinate and implement patient teaching initiatives
• Advocate for clinical teams and patient resources
• Evaluate evidence-based practice changes in care delivery
• Lead development of clinical pathways and care guidelines
Requirements:
• Registered Nurse in good standing with the College of Nurses of Ontario
• Bachelor’s Degree in Nursing and Critical Care certificate
• 3-5 years in a Level 3 Cardiac critical care unit
• ACLS and BCLS certifications required
• Preferred:
Clinical Nurse Educator experience
